Understanding Gluten-Free Diets
Before diving into the specifics of gluten-free brownie mixes, it’s essential to understand the basics of gluten-free diets. Gluten is a protein found in wheat, barley, and rye, and it can cause adverse reactions in individuals with celiac disease, non-celiac gluten sensitivity, or wheat allergy. A gluten-free diet excludes foods containing gluten, requiring those who follow it to be vigilant about the ingredients in the foods they consume. This includes baked goods, which often rely on wheat flour as a primary ingredient.

Gluten-Free Flours and Ingredients
Gluten-free baking mixes, including those for brownies, typically consist of a blend of gluten-free flours and other ingredients. Common gluten-free flours include almond flour, coconut flour, rice flour, and teff flour, each with its unique characteristics and challenges in baking. In addition to these flours, gluten-free brownie mixes may include other ingredients such as sugar, cocoa powder, eggs, and additives to enhance flavor and texture. The formulation of these mixes is crucial, as it must balance the lack of gluten with other ingredients to achieve a palatable and satisfying product.

Reading Labels and Understanding Certifications
When shopping for a gluten-free brownie mix, it’s essential to read labels carefully and look for certifications that ensure the product meets gluten-free standards. The Gluten-Free Certification Organization (GFCO) and the Celiac Support Association (CSA) are two prominent organizations that certify gluten-free products. These certifications provide assurance that the product has been manufactured in a facility that adheres to strict gluten-free standards, minimizing the risk of cross-contamination.

For those interested in exploring gluten-free baking further, here is a list of popular gluten-free flours and their characteristics:
- Almond flour: Made from ground almonds, it’s a popular choice for gluten-free baking due to its nutty flavor and high protein content.
- Coconut flour: Derived from dried and ground coconut, it’s high in fiber and protein but absorbs more liquid than traditional flour, requiring adjustments in recipes.
- Rice flour: Light and delicate, rice flour is often used in combination with other flours to achieve the right texture in gluten-free baked goods.
- Teff flour: An ancient grain native to Ethiopia, teff flour is nutrient-rich and has a slightly sweet, molasses-like flavor.

What is gluten-free baking and how does it differ from traditional baking?
Gluten-free baking refers to the process of preparing baked goods without using ingredients that contain gluten, a type of protein found in wheat, barley, and rye. This type of baking is essential for individuals with gluten-related disorders, such as celiac disease or non-celiac gluten sensitivity, as consuming gluten can cause adverse health effects. Gluten-free baking requires the use of alternative flours and ingredients that can mimic the texture and structure of gluten-containing baked goods.
The main difference between gluten-free baking and traditional baking lies in the types of flours used. Traditional baking relies on wheat flour, which contains gluten, to provide structure and texture to baked goods. In contrast, gluten-free baking uses a combination of alternative flours, such as almond flour, coconut flour, or rice flour, to achieve the desired texture. Additionally, gluten-free baking often requires the use of xanthan gum or guar gum to help bind ingredients together and improve the texture of the final product. With the right combination of ingredients and techniques, gluten-free baking can produce delicious and satisfying treats that are safe for individuals with gluten-related disorders to consume.

How do gluten-free brownies differ from traditional brownies in terms of taste and texture?
Gluten-free brownies can differ from traditional brownies in terms of taste and texture, depending on the types of ingredients used. Gluten-free flours can impart a slightly different flavor and texture to baked goods, which some people may find appealing while others may not. For example, almond flour can add a nutty flavor and a denser texture, while coconut flour can add a sweeter flavor and a lighter texture. Additionally, gluten-free brownies may be more prone to drying out or becoming crumbly, due to the lack of gluten.
However, with the right combination of ingredients and techniques, gluten-free brownies can be just as rich and fudgy as traditional brownies. Many gluten-free brownie recipes include additional ingredients, such as xanthan gum or guar gum, to help improve the texture and structure of the final product. Additionally, using high-quality cocoa powder and other flavorings can help to create a deep and intense chocolate flavor that is similar to traditional brownies. With a little experimentation and patience, you can create gluten-free brownies that are delicious and satisfying, and that meet your dietary needs and preferences.
